Key Features

  • Tiger Eye high-reliability locking contact system ensures secure mating and prevents accidental disconnection under vibration
  • Dual-row SMT configuration with 0.050-inch (1.27 mm) pitch enables high-density board-to-board signal routing
  • Integrated polarization key (P) prevents improper insertion during automated and manual assembly
  • Tape-and-reel (TR) packaging supports high-speed SMT pick-and-place manufacturing at volume

Applications

The TFM-121-12-S-D-A-P-TR is designed for high-reliability board-to-board signal interconnect in industrial, defense, and medical electronics requiring secure locking connectors. Its Tiger Eye contact geometry provides robust mechanical retention under vibration and thermal cycling, making it suitable for ruggedized equipment and harsh environments. The compact 0.050-inch pitch SMT footprint enables dense PCB layouts in demanding space-constrained applications.

Frequently Asked Questions

What pitch and row configuration does the SAMTEC TFM-121-12-S-D-A-P-TR use for SMT board-to-board interconnect?

The TFM-121-12-S-D-A-P-TR features a dual-row SMT configuration with 0.050-inch (1.27 mm) pitch, providing a high-density footprint for board-to-board signal routing. This layout accommodates many contact positions in a compact space, ideal for data-intensive multi-signal interconnects in industrial and defense electronics.

How does the Tiger Eye locking mechanism benefit designs operating across wide temperature ranges?

The Tiger Eye locking mechanism maintains contact integrity under continuous vibration and shock across an operating temperature range of -55°C to +125°C. This makes the TFM-121-12-S-D-A-P-TR suitable for defense avionics, ruggedized industrial controllers, and medical imaging equipment exposed to repeated mechanical stress and thermal cycling.

When should designers choose the TFM-121-12-S-D-A-P-TR over a standard non-locking terminal strip?

Designers should choose this connector when their application requires positive retention under shock or vibration, such as in avionics line-replaceable units or downhole tools operating up to +125°C. The polarization key also prevents miswiring across dual-row signal buses with 50 or more pins, reducing costly PCB rework in high-reliability assemblies.
